Learn the basics of Microsoft Excel 2010, an essential tool you need to know in today's job market.

We will learn how to input data, use labels, create basic functions, insert a chart, and have fun with page layouts. Not for beginners. Students must have basic computer skills. Class is limited to 10 and is first come/first served.

About the branch

Gibson Library is located in the Lake Mead Crossings Center on W. Lake Mead Pkwy. and S. Water St. This location features a drive-thru window, a computer lab, and study rooms.
